The Historical Context of Remembrance

Remembrance Day, initially known as Armistice Day, originated from the cessation of hostilities on the Western Front of World War I, which took effect on the eleventh hour of the eleventh day of the eleventh month of 1918. The sheer scale of loss during the Great War – millions of lives cut short – prompted a need for collective mourning and remembrance. Initially, the focus was primarily on commemorating those who died in that specific conflict. However, over time, its scope broadened to include the remembrance of all those who had died in subsequent wars, acknowledging the sacrifices made in conflicts across the globe. The poppy, now synonymous with Remembrance Day, became a symbol of remembrance following its association with the red fields of Flanders, where so many battles were fought.

The Importance of Mental Health Support

The psychological toll of war can be profound and long-lasting. Many veterans experience post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), anxiety, depression, and other mental health conditions. Access to timely and effective mental health care is crucial for helping veterans cope with these challenges and rebuild their lives. Breaking down the stigma associated with mental illness is also essential, encouraging veterans to seek help without fear of judgment. Organizations specializing in veteran mental health provide a range of therapeutic interventions, including individual counseling, group therapy, and peer support programs. Supporting veterans’ mental well-being is a direct extension of honoring their service and sacrifice.
